How popular is the name Mahammed?

Births per year, rank history and how many Mahammeds are alive today.

Mahammed (male) is a rare boys' name in England and Wales, ranked 5120th in 2024 and given to 3 babies. The name peaked in 2006, when 19 babies were given the name, the 1127th most popular that year. It has declined since 2006; the 2024 figure is roughly 16% of its peak.

The Mahammed you are most likely to meet is around 21 years old. Half of all Mahammeds born in England and Wales are between 16 and 26, and there are at least 220 of them alive today. If you walk into a room of 100 males, there's less than a 1% chance that anyone will be called Mahammed - on average, only one in every 1,378 such rooms contains a Mahammed.

Where this data comes from

Figures from 1996 onwards are the Office for National Statistics' annual baby-name registrations for England and Wales, which record every name given to three or more babies in a year. Figures before 1996 are estimates: the ONS published only top-100 rankings at ten-year intervals back to 1904, so counts for those years are modelled from the rankings, calibrated against Douglas Galbi's long-run research into English name frequencies, and shown with an uncertainty band. Estimates of living bearers combine these birth figures with national life tables and ONS mid-year population estimates.

One limit worth naming: these figures count names as registered at birth. Anyone who changes their name later in life - including trans people, and anyone who adopts a different name by deed poll or simply by use - is not reflected here. Birth registrations record where a name began, not the name a person lives with.
